New Game Round-up: Sherlock's New Look, Another Visit to Middle-earth & More

• Moonster Games has posted images of the "Dragoon" clan from Gosu: Kamakor, due out late August/early September 2011 in Europe and one month afterwards in North America.

• Flying Frog Productions has released English rules (PDF) for Fortune and Glory: The Cliffhanger Game.

• Ystari Games posted sample illustrations from its new version of Sherlock Holmes Consulting Detective on its blog, mentioning a release date of late 2011 or early 2012.

• MTV Geek reports that at Comic-Con 2011 in San Diego, Steve Jackson Games revealed that it will release a Munchkin booster pack in Q2 2012 based on the web series The Guild.

• Looney Labs is releasing two promotional postcards on September 30, 2011: Star Fluxx: Android Doctor to tie into the release of Star Fluxx on the same day, and Fluxx: Press Your Luck, which can be used in any version of Fluxx.

• New games in the BGG database include:

-----* Alba Longa, from Graeme Jahns and Quined/Tasty Minstrel/HUCH – This game is not about one's desire for Jessica Alba, but rather about competition for dominance in early Italy. Technically, this is not a new game as the design was one of four winners of the 2009 Concours International de Créateurs de Jeux de Société, but now Dutch publisher Quined Games has picked up the title and further developed it, with two co-publishers also releasing the game.

-----* Lord of the Rings: Nazgul, from Brian Kinsella and WizKids – The players are all minions of Sauron and must work together to keep the Ringbearer from reaching Mount Doom. If they do, the player with the most VPs wins. If not, then they fall with their master...

-----* Frigiti, from Andrea Meyer and BeWitched Spiele – A combination dice/word game with bluffing elements

-----* [thing=103723]Merchant of Death[/thing], from Steve Finn through Doctor Finn's Card Company – Players use their agents to confiscate crates of weapons at various locations around the world.

-----* Prepotent, from Tom Russell and Numbskull Games – Due out before the end of 2011, this game combines horse breeding, betting and racing.

-----* Cookie Fu: Grandmaster Chi Battles, also know as Cookie Fu Fortune Decks, from Bryan Kowalski and Blue Kabuto – These decks come in three flavors (Chocolate Ox, Vanilla Hare and Coconut Monkey) that match those of the Cookie Fu dice game, but these decks can be integrated into the dice game or used on their own in a fast two-player combat game. Cookie Fu Fortune Decks will debut at Gen Con 2011, which opens in early August.
